Trondheim, Norway--(Newsfile Corp. - June 11, 2024) - Revolutionary app company Minds.et AS launches globally for mental health and self-development. It was founded by Hartvig Tryggvason Reinfjord, Konrad Tryggvason Reinfjord, and Elias Lamo, three serial entrepreneurs from Norway, behind companies like SSEO.com, HKMarked.no, Documenting.com, and many more. This unique platform was created to help its users live better lives, and in a move toward expanded accessibility, the company has unveiled its new app.

About Minds.et AS:

Minds.et is a company based in Trondheim, Norway. It was founded in 2023 with a mission to make mental health support widely available to all by breaking down barriers and changing societal taboos associated with mental health issues. Through its pioneering online platform and the newly launched innovative mobile app, Minds.et is revolutionizing the way individuals perceive mental health and access mental health support and self-development resources.
